Medtronic, Inc. et al v. AGA Medical Corporation

Filing 739

ORDER GRANTING IN PART AND DENYING IN PART MEDTRONIC'S ADMINISTRATIVE MOTION TO FILE DOCUMENTS UNDER SEAL. Medtronic shall file in the public record, no later than July 2, 2009, Exhibit 1 to the Sinclair Declaration and a redacted version of the Sinclair Declaration, redacting only the material found to be sealable. Signed by Judge Maxine M. Chesney on June 30, 2009. (mmclc2, COURT STAFF) (Filed on 6/30/2009)
